
Syracuse Loses to Cyclones at Cy-Hawk; Ball State On Deck Saturday
9/10/2021 8:10:00 PM | Volleyball
SYRACUSE, N.Y. – The Orange lost to Iowa State in a five-set match, 3-2, on Friday at the Cy-Hawk Series Tournament at the University of Iowa. Senior Polina Shemanova recorded a season-high 26 kills on a .362 hitting percentage and recorded 14 digs for the Orange (7-1 overall, 0-0 ACC).
"We played a better team tonight," said head coach Leonid Yelin. "We needed more people to produce, and we just couldn't get there. There was an opportunity in the fifth set, we were the first team to eight, but we got tired and lost focus. Now it's time to recover both mentally and physically after a long match and reset for tomorrow."
The Orange came out rolling in the first set, going on a 6-0 run before the Cyclones (6-1) could get on the board. Iowa State battled back to make it a close set in the Orange's 25-20 win. Set two was nearly a foil of the first, with Iowa State opening the set 5-1. Syracuse never took the lead in the second, losing 25-21. Syracuse battled the Cyclones in the third set, earning its first lead at 21-20 after being down as many as five and won the set 25-22. The fourth set was back and forth until the Cyclones went on a 6-0 run to take an 18-10 lead and won the set 25-19. Iowa State won the fifth set, 15-11 to seal the victory in the match.
